Describe Big data
Large collection of data gathered from inside or outside company to provide opportunities for ongoing reporting analysis
what two formats of Big data and give an example of each?
Structured: memo and reports
Unstructured: Videos, pictures, audio
Discuss the 5 Vs
Variety
Volume - gather, clean, organize and analyze
Velocity - rate data received and acted on
Value - expenditure of time and money to analyze big data that give insights
Veracity - accurate and trustworthy

Describe the 7 difference between Financial and Managerial
- Reports to outside of organization vs reports inside the organization
- Past activities vs decisions with future
- objectivity and verifiability vs relevance
- Precision vs Timeliness
- Summary of data vs detailed segment for reports about departments
- Must follow GAAP vs not following any rules
- Mandatory vs not Mandatory
